Alloy 718, UNS N07718

Microstructure

Alloy 718 is an age-hardenable austenitic material. Strength is largely dependent on the precipitation of the primary phase during heat treatment.

Alloy 718 Characteristics

Good fabricability in the annealed condition;

Good tensile, fatigue, and creep-rupture strengths, up to 700℃;

High-temperature strength up to 700℃;

Good oxidation resistance up to 1000℃;

Excellent mechanical properties in cryogenic environments;

Good weldability by arc welding without susceptibility to post-weld cracking.

Corrosion Resistance

Alloy 718 has excellent corrosion resistance to many media. This resistance, which is similar to that of other nickel-chromium alloys, is a function of its composition. Nickel contributes to corrosion resistance in many inorganic and organic compounds (other than strongly oxidizing compounds) across a wide range of acidity and alkalinity. It also helps in combating chloride-ion stress-corrosion cracking. Chromium imparts the ability to withstand attack by oxidizing media and sulfur compounds. Molybdenum is known to contribute to resistance to pitting in many media.

Applications

Due to its high-temperature strength up to 700℃, excellent corrosion resistance, and ease of fabrication, Alloy 718 finds applications in many fields. Initially, it was used as a turbine disk material in aircraft jet engines, where resistance to creep and stress rupture was most important. Because of its properties, fabricability, and cost-effectiveness, it has since gained wider acceptance. Today, applications vary from highly stressed rotating and static components in gas turbines and rocket engines to high-strength bolting, springs, and fasteners, components in nuclear reactors and space vehicles, as well as high-temperature tooling for extrusion, such as for copper, and shearing. Another important recent application involves pump shafts and other highly stressed wellhead and downhole components in offshore drilling equipment. Particularly useful is the alloy for drilling equipment in sour (containing H2S, CO2, and chlorides) oil and gas wells.
